Indexer Notes

Story had three parts. First part has 7.5 pages with a half page advertisement on page marked 8. Second part has 7.5 pages with a half page promo Flash (DC, 1959 series) #177 on page marked 16. The third and final part has 6.5 pages and has the half page Boltinoff humor comic filler Billy on page marked 23.

Parts 2 and 3 are titled, "The Liquidator!"

Statement of Ownership, Management and Circulation (Table of Contents: 4)

statement of ownership / 0.33 page (report information)

Script
Irwin Donenfeld
Letters
typeset

Indexer Notes

Date of Filing: October 1st, 1967.
Total No. Copies Printed (Net Press Run):
Average no. copies each issue during preceding 12 months--404,000, single issue nearest to filing date--310,000.
Total Paid Circulation:
Average no. copies each issue during preceding 12 months--234,200, single issue nearest to filing date--177,900.
